The Engadin Worldloppet: Mattress Downhill or Optional Walk-Around?

Long-time Lumi guest Gunnar Knapp shares his experiences from skiing the 2026 Engadin Ski Marathon in Switzerland. As part of a Lumi Experiences trip, he not only explored the Engadin Valley but also completed his tenth Worldloppet, earning the prestigious Worldloppet Master Diploma and gold medal. His journal captures both the beauty of the region and the joy of skiing the iconic Engadin course.
